If it makes it easier to understand, see Messi playing for Barcelona. Clearly he is not playing right wing, however generally wanders out that way and his responsibility in the press is on that side. We don't play wingers, which is obviously causing problems for Kent, but that's another story. Our width comes from full backs. Hagi is not what we currently call a centre midfielder, however the position probably was called midfield in the days of maradona etc. Either way, Hagi has been playing in his position in a system that he likes, and actually spoke about this as part of the reason he wanted to play for us.Everything you have described about this number ten position is not the way we’re playing Haji, infact playing somebody just behind Morelos would improve his game and most certainly improve our attacking side of the game, how hard is it for you to understand this.

Tav has actually been way better at defending this season young boys away apart but goals and assists have dried up. Do we cash in on him or keep? Decent player but has value and question is who would replace him at right back and captain?
Barisic - I'd keep if others are sold to fund upgrades elsewhere. Classy and showed his worth particularly in Europe but still think more to come from him if we don't sell.
Katic - has had some great games and some awful ones but is young and can improve. I'd keep.
Goldson - is better than is given credit for and has had some excellent games with an odd bad one. Would cost plenty to replace properly.
Edmondson - young and full of promise and could be brilliant in long term so keep.
Helander - cost plenty, looked good in Europe not so good v Dykes. I think Gerrard rates him so he will be kept.
Davis - deent still despite age. One more year perhaps but then what? Doc? McCrory? Sign someone else?
Jack - keep. Cant see us wanting to part with RJ and rightly so.
Kamara - on his day can be excellent but may be sold if right bid received as is still sought by a few down south so who knows.
Arfield - has been excellent of late and is of an age where no one will pay big money so keep him for a year or two.
Kent - will be kept and on his game can be great. Needs to do it more and maybe others will be interested. Cant see us selling.
Barker - allegedly excellent in training but not seen much in games but would anyone buy?
Stewart - looks good when given a chance but not given enough chances. Useful to have but will he accept bit part role. Could have a bit of value but not silly sums.
Defoe - 1 more year maximum despite being great finisher.
Morelos - great player but a distraction and sideshow at times and target for bigots racists and refs. Can see us cashing in and moving on sadly but only if the price is correct. Who replaces him?
Hagi - buy if he keeps up his excellent play..
Docherty - showing up well for Hibs. Will he get a chance back with us?
